Alpha no longer makes windows.
Anderson Renewal is among the best but about twice the cost per unit. [ They do use sub-contractors for the install, as do 99% of all companies]
Triple glass is better than Double, but you have to weigh the extra cost . Skip the Heat mirror, sun shield and the 100 other names unless the window gets direct sun for many hours. All it does is reflect the suns heat in the summer ,nothing else. The Warm Edge Spacer is Great No metal in it. It is the object that is between the panes of glass. Skip Home Depot and LOWES.
Be aware that any and all samples you see in the show room or at your home are built with extra special care [ GOT IT ??]
Life time Warranty ! ON WHAT ? Should say All parts and glass. And how many years for Labor.
Get everything, I mean everything the sales guy says in writing. EI rotted or damaged wood replaced. If he says Broken/damaged stop molding replaced. WRITE IT. Most times Aluminum and steel window removal does not include stop molding.

The make of the windows is just half of the equation. The installation is the other half. If the installation is done well, then you're set. If it's lousy, those new windows will be rotting from water within 5 years.
